Te main problem with the Seismic sub is it's size and weight (see link). I was part of the Chicago Horn Club crew that did the move in/and out back in the oughties when Bruce demo'd the Titan rig at a Chicago Audio Society meet here. It was like moving a large refrigerator. Also to be considered for subwoofer duty are the Danley Labhorn and Taped horn which perform very well and are referenced on the volvotreter link. I have'nt heard any of Bill Fitzmaurice's subwoofers yet but they certainly look like good candidates for DIY subs. However I live in a 130 year old wood house, and I gave up on the idea of making a horn loaded subwoofer after hearing some of the Danley designs actually shaking the old houses they were demo'd in. Forget about harmonic distortion in the playback equipment, with horn subs in old houses you run into exciting harmonic resonances in the house itself!
